Healthcare workflow context
The product supports clinical workflows for doctors and nurses including patient worklists with Waiting, Active and Done states, structured SOAP consultation notes, allergy information, ICD-10 support, AI suggestions, voice dictation, medication orders, laboratory orders, radiology orders, urgent flags and stock-aware medication information with review and acceptance of AI recommendations on Android phone and tablet.
AI suggestions are presented as review-oriented assistance where clinicians review and decide, rather than autonomous decisions. Consultation and order screens keep allergy and admission context visible to support safe review.
